rooftents, also known as rooftop tents or RTTs, are gaining popularity among outdoor enthusiasts looking for a hassle-free way to camp. These innovative tents are mounted on top of a vehicle, providing a safe and elevated sleeping space that is protected from the elements. They come in various shapes and sizes, accommodating different numbers of campers and gear. Whether you’re a solo adventurer or traveling with friends and family, there’s a rooftop tent that suits your needs.

One of the biggest advantages of rooftop camping is the ease of setup and takedown. Unlike traditional ground tents that require you to find a flat and clear spot to pitch, rooftop tents can be unfolded in minutes, allowing you to spend more time enjoying your surroundings. Most rooftop tents come with built-in mattresses, eliminating the need to carry bulky sleeping pads and bags. This means you can pack light and maximize the space in your vehicle for other gear and supplies.

Another benefit of rooftop tents is their versatility. They can be mounted on a variety of vehicles, from SUVs and trucks to trailers and even sedans with roof racks. This flexibility allows you to turn your daily driver into a mobile campsite, turning any road trip into a camping adventure. rooftents are also ideal for off-road enthusiasts who want to explore remote destinations without sacrificing comfort. With a rooftop tent, you can access hard-to-reach camping spots and enjoy a peaceful night under the stars.

When choosing a rooftop tent, there are a few factors to consider. Firstly, you’ll need to determine the size and weight capacity that fits your vehicle and camping needs. Some rooftop tents are designed for solo campers, while others can accommodate multiple people. It’s important to make sure that your vehicle’s roof rack can support the weight of the tent, as well as any additional gear you plan to carry.

Next, think about the features you want in a rooftop tent. Some models come with built-in awnings, windows, and ventilation systems to enhance your camping experience. Others have annex rooms that provide extra living space or privacy for changing and storing gear. Consider whether you prefer a hard-shell or soft-shell tent, as each has its own pros and cons in terms of durability, insulation, and ease of use.

Maintenance is also key when it comes to rooftop tents. Make sure to regularly check the tent’s condition, including the zippers, fabric, and poles, to ensure it stays in good shape. Store the tent properly when not in use, keeping it clean and dry to prevent mold and mildew. With proper care, a rooftop tent can last for years and provide countless memorable adventures.
